Tris(4-acetylaminophenyl) thiophosphate, also known as TAFTP, is a chemical compound with the molecular formula C21H24NO6PS. It is a derivative of tris(4-aminophenyl) thiophosphate (TAP), where each of the three amino groups in TAP is acetylated. TAFTP is a colorless, crystalline solid that is soluble in organic solvents. It is primarily used as an intermediate in the synthesis of various organophosphorus compounds, including pesticides and flame retardants. Due to its potential toxicity and environmental impact, TAFTP is subject to strict regulations and safety measures during its production, use, and disposal.

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 75144-41-1 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 7,5,1,4 and 4 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 4 and 1 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 75144-41:
(7*7)+(6*5)+(5*1)+(4*4)+(3*4)+(2*4)+(1*1)=121
121 % 10 = 1
So 75144-41-1 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Preparation method of thiophosphoric acid tri (4-aminobenzene) ester

-

Paragraph 0096; 0098-0102, (2021/07/24)

The invention relates to a preparation method of thiophosphoric acid tri (4-aminobenzene) ester. Specifically, according to the preparation method of the thiophosphoric acid tris (4-aminobenzene) ester, acetaminophen and thiophosphoryl chloride are used as raw materials, and esterification and hydrolysis reactions are performed in sequence to obtain the thiophosphoric acid tris (4-aminobenzene) ester. The synthesis method of thiophosphate tri (4-aminobenzene) ester has the advantages of short synthesis route, simple process operation, mild reaction conditions, short reaction time, fast reaction speed, strong selectivity, high yield, high purity, low cost, avoidance of expensive and highly toxic reagents and catalysts, environmental protection and easy industrial production.
